包括的なガイド: GroupDocs.Conversion for .NET を使用して VSSM を TXT に変換する

導入

Microsoft Visio マクロ対応(VSSM)ファイルを、より扱いやすいプレーンテキスト形式に変換したいとお考えですか? あなただけではありません。多くの開発者や企業は、特にデータの抽出やシステムのシームレスな統合において、独自のファイル形式による課題に直面しています。このチュートリアルでは、GroupDocs.Conversion for .NET を使用して VSSM ファイルを TXT に変換する方法について説明します。

学習内容:

  • GroupDocs.Conversion for .NET の設定と使用方法
  • VSSM ファイルを TXT 形式に変換する手順
  • 変換中のパフォーマンスを最適化するためのベストプラクティス

このチュートリアルでは、強力な.NETライブラリを使用してVSSMファイルを効率的にプレーンテキストに変換するために必要なスキルを習得します。始める前に、前提条件を確認しましょう。

前提条件

GroupDocs.Conversion for .NET の使用を開始するには、次のものを用意してください。

  • 必要なライブラリGroupDocs.Conversion バージョン 25.3.0 が必要です。
  • 環境設定このガイドでは、互換性のある .NET 環境 (.NET Core や .NET Framework など) を使用していることを前提としています。
  • 知識の前提条件C# と .NET でのファイル処理に関する基本的な知識があると役立ちます。

GroupDocs.Conversion for .NET のセットアップ

インストール

まず、NuGet パッケージ マネージャー コンソールまたは .NET CLI を使用して、GroupDocs.Conversion をプロジェクトに追加します。

NuGet パッケージ マネージャー コンソール

Install-Package GroupDocs.Conversion -Version 25.3.0

.NET CLI

dotnet add package GroupDocs.Conversion --version 25.3.0

ライセンス取得

GroupDocs.Conversion をご利用いただくには、無料トライアルから始めるか、テスト目的で一時ライセンスを取得してください。本番環境では、すべての機能をご利用いただけるフルライセンスのご購入をご検討ください。

基本的な初期化とセットアップ

C# プロジェクトで GroupDocs.Conversion ライブラリを初期化する方法は次のとおりです。

using System;
using GroupDocs.Conversion;

namespace VSSMToTXTConversion
{
    class Program
    {
        static void Main(string[] args)
        {
            // ライセンスをお持ちの場合は初期化してください
            License license = new License();
            license.SetLicense("Path to your license file");
            
            Console.WriteLine("GroupDocs.Conversion initialized successfully.");
        }
    }
}

実装ガイド

このセクションでは、GroupDocs.Conversion を使用して VSSM ファイルを TXT 形式に変換するプロセスについて説明します。

ステップ1: 出力ディレクトリとファイル名を定義する

まず、変換したTXTファイルの出力ディレクトリのパスとファイル名を設定します。これにより、変換されたファイルが指定された場所に保存されます。

using System.IO;

string outputFolder = @"YOUR_OUTPUT_DIRECTORY";
string outputFile = Path.Combine(outputFolder, "vssm-converted-to.txt");

ステップ2: ソースVSSMファイルをロードする

ソースVSSMファイルをロードするには、 Converter クラス。このステップは、変換用の入力ファイルを設定するため非常に重要です。

using (var converter = new Converter(@"YOUR_DOCUMENT_DIRECTORY\sample.vssm"))
{
    // 変換手順はここをご覧ください
}

ステップ3: 変換オプションを設定する

変換オプションを定義して、VSSMファイルをTXT形式に変換することを指定します。この手順では、ファイルの変換方法を設定します。

using GroupDocs.Conversion.Options.Convert;

WordProcessingConvertOptions options = new WordProcessingConvertOptions { Format = FileType.Txt };

ステップ4: 変換を実行する

最後に、変換を実行し、出力を指定したパスに保存します。これで変換プロセスは完了です。

csv converter.Convert(outputFile, options);

実用的なアプリケーション

  1. データ抽出分析またはレポートのために VSSM ファイルからテキスト データを抽出します。
  2. システム統合プレーンテキスト入力を必要とするシステムに Visio 図を統合します。
  3. コンテンツの移行Visio から TXT 形式をサポートする他のプラットフォームにコンテンツを移行します。

これらのユースケースは、さまざまなシナリオで VSSM から TXT への変換がいかに多用途かつ便利であるかを示しています。

パフォーマンスに関する考慮事項

変換中に最適なパフォーマンスを確保するには:

  • リソース使用の最適化不要になったオブジェクトを破棄することで、メモリを効率的に管理します。
  • ベストプラクティス応答性を向上させるために、可能な場合は非同期メソッドを活用します。

これらのガイドラインは、アプリケーションの効率と安定性を維持するのに役立ちます。

結論

このチュートリアルでは、GroupDocs.Conversion for .NET を使用して VSSM ファイルを TXT に変換する方法を学習しました。ライブラリの設定、変換パラメータの定義、そしてプロセスの実行方法について説明しました。次のステップとして、GroupDocs.Conversion でサポートされている他のファイル形式を調べて、アプリケーションの機能を拡張することを検討してください。

行動喚起今すぐこのソリューションをプロジェクトに実装して、データ処理プロセスがいかに効率化されるかを確認してください。

FAQセクション

  1. VSSM とは何ですか?

    • VSSM は Microsoft Visio マクロ対応ファイル形式の略で、マクロが埋め込まれた図表を保存するために使用されます。
  2. GroupDocs.Conversion を使用して他の形式を変換できますか?

    • はい、GroupDocs.Conversion は幅広いドキュメントおよび画像形式をサポートしています。
  3. 変換に失敗した場合はどうすればいいですか?

    • 入力ファイルのパスを確認し、すべての依存関係が正しくインストールされていることを確認してください。
  4. GroupDocs.Conversion for .NET を使用するには費用がかかりますか?

    • 無料トライアルは利用可能ですが、本番環境で使用するにはライセンスを購入する必要があります。
  5. 問題が発生した場合、どうすればサポートを受けることができますか?

    • サポートが必要な場合は、GroupDocs フォーラムにアクセスするか、詳細なドキュメントを参照してください。

リソース

このチュートリアルでは、GroupDocs.Conversion for .NET をプロジェクトに効果的に実装するための知識を習得できます。コーディングを楽しみましょう!